Cementitious Wasteforms for Immobilization of Low-Activity Radioactive Wastes

Solidification of low-activity wastes with cementitious materials is a widely accepted technique that contains and isolates waste from the hydrologic environment. The radionuclides I-129, Se-75, Tc-99, and U-238 are identified as long-term dose contributors. The anionic nature of these radionuclides in aqueous solutions allows them to readily leach into the subsurface environment. Assessing the long-term performance of waste grouts requires understanding the speciation and interaction of radionuclides within the concrete wasteform, their diffusion when contacted with vadose zone porewater or groundwater, and the durability and weathering of concrete waste forms. An integrated laboratory investigation was conducted involving spectroscopic investigations, solubility tests, and quantifying diffusion and long-term durability under realistic moisture contents. Additionally, the study identified secondary phases or processes that influence radionuclide retention. Results yield critical insights into the behavior and fate of radionuclides immobilized within concrete wasteforms, underscoring the necessity for robust performance assessments for concrete waste forms under vadose zone conditions.
